## Releases

StormFan handles weather-alert fan-out for the Perrow region. Releases are tagged monthly from `main`. CI builds the bundle, runs the replay suite against archived alert streams, and pushes to the Calder registry. Hotfixes branch from the last tag only. Every bundle must be signed or the fan-out nodes refuse it; verification happens at boot and on every config reload. Keep the changelog current. All release bundles are signed with the key below.

signing key of bagap-yawep = bky13_TbfT6ZMUoGJo2

Re: Retirement of the Corvane Product Line

Effective end of Q2, Tarnwell Systems will retire the Corvane line. Revenue has declined three consecutive years; support costs now exceed margin. Existing customers migrate to Helvette on discounted terms through year-end. Manufacturing at the Dunmore facility winds down over ninety days; affected staff redeploy to Helvette operations where possible. Legal is finalizing end-of-life notices. Board vote requested at the next session. Strategic context for this decision follows below.

management briefing: Headcount on the Beldor team goes from 26 to 123 by the end of February. Gross margin on Beldor came in at 5 percent against a plan of 37 percent.

## Flaky DNS on the Quillhaven edge boxes

Heads up: customers on the Quillhaven edge tier sometimes see intermittent NXDOMAIN for perfectly valid hosts. It's almost always the stale resolver cache on node pools that missed last month's patch. Flush the cache, retry, and if it still flakes, pull the resolver logs through the diag relay. The relay wants authentication, so use the service key below.

API key for tagug-tajef: vxb4-R1fo